Who is the most famous female Native American?

One of the best-known women of the American West, the native-born Sacagawea gained renown for her crucial role in helping the Lewis & Clark expedition successfully reach the Pacific coast. Born in 1788 or 1789 in what is now Idaho, Sacagawea was a member of the Lemhi band of the Native American Shoshone tribe.

What is a female Indian chief called?

chieftess
A woman who holds a chieftaincy in her own right or who derives one from her marriage to a male chief has been referred to alternatively as a chieftainess, a chieftess or, especially in the case of the former, a chief.

What does Winona mean?

firstborn daughter
Meaning. “firstborn daughter” Winona is a feminine given name, an Anglicized form of the Dakota descriptive term, Winúŋna, meaning “firstborn daughter.”

How do you come up with a Native American name?

Native American naming traditions, vary greatly from tribe to tribe. Native American Names are basically drawn from nature. However, Native American Baby names could also be descriptive or chosen as nicknames e.g. little black eyes. Native American Names might also be based on the gender and birth position of the baby.
